Filbert and Lychee have convex indifference curves. Note Filbert is indifferent between baskets (3, 2) and (4, 1)--these are x, y coordinates. Lychee is indifferent between baskets (1, 4) and (2, 3) Not that all four baskets lie along a straight line.
a.) Can you determine whether Filbert and Lychee have identical tastes?
b.) Suppose that Filbert chooses (4,1) and Lychee chooses basket (1, 4). Can you determine whether Filbert and Lychee pay identical prices for the goods they buy?
